The Application of Discrete Hilbert transform in Measuring Asset Return Risk in Investment Portfolios Ekasasmita, Wahyuni; Tunnisa, Khaera; Aditya, Muh. Tri
Jurnal Akuntansi, Keuangan, dan Manajemen Vol. 6 No. 2 (2025): Maret
Publisher : Penerbit Goodwood

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.35912/jakman.v6i2.3803

Abstract

AbstractPurpose: This study aims to explore the application of the discrete Hilbert transform (DHT) in measuring asset return risk within a portfolio, emphasizing its potential for enhancing risk evaluation in the field of financial mathematics.Methodology/approach: The research utilized a quantitative approach with data sourced from publicly available historical stock prices. Analysis was conducted using software MATLAB to implement the discrete Hilbert transform, which transforms time-series data into phase and amplitude components. The portfolio risk was calculated based on the transformed data, and the results were compared against traditional risk metrics such as variance and Value at Risk (VaR).Results/findings: The findings indicate that the discrete Hilbert transform provides additional insights into portfolio risk by capturing frequency-domain characteristics of asset returns. It complements traditional measures, offering a novel perspective on risk analysis. Specifically, the discrete Hilbert transform was effective in identifying subtle changes in risk patterns that were not apparent in time-domain analyses alone.Conclusion: This study investigates the application of the discrete Hilbert transform (DHT) in measuring the risk of asset returns within investment portfolios, specifically focusing on Indonesian stocks. TheLimitations: This study is limited by its focus on a small sample of stocks within a single financial market, which may restrict the generalizability of the findings. Additionally, the research does not account for macroeconomic factors that could influence asset returns.Contribution: This study contributes to the field of financial risk management by introducing the discrete Hilbert transform as a supplementary tool for risk analysis. It offers practical implications for portfolio managers, actuaries, and financial analysts seeking innovative methods to enhance risk assessment and decision-making processes.

The Agricultural Insurance: Explore Trends and Advances Over the Last Two Decades ADRIANI, IKA RESKIANA; Ekasasmita, Wahyuni; Afriansyah, Dilla; Zahra, Khoiruz
Mandalika Mathematics and Educations Journal Vol 7 No 2 (2025): Edisi Juni
Publisher : FKIP Universitas Mataram

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.29303/jm.v7i2.9018

Abstract

The agricultural sector faces major risks due to extreme climate change, market uncertainty and economic fluctuations, which can destabilize global food production. Agricultural insurance, despite its importance as a risk mitigation tool for farmers, still has limited article reviews compared to other insurance sectors such as health, life, and property. This study aims to conduct a bibliometric analysis of global research on agricultural insurance over the past two decades, focusing on publication trends, the most influential countries and journals, keyword analysis, and providing directions for future research. The study used data from Scopus with a total of 643 documents. Analysis was conducted using VOS viewer, RStudio, and Tableau to visualize collaboration patterns, dominant keywords, and global publication trends. The analysis shows a significant increase in the number of studies on agricultural insurance, which reinforces the urgency of insurance in supporting global food stability. The implications of this research point to the need to develop insurance models that are technology-based and more adaptive to climate change, especially to expand access for smallholder farmers in developing countries. Recommendations for future research are to strengthen cross-sector collaboration and technological innovation to support the sustainability and resilience of the agricultural sector in the future.
OPTIMIZING DEFINED BENEFIT PENSION PLAN FUNDING: COMBINING ENTRY AGE NORMAL METHOD AND SINGLE SALARY APPROACH Ekasasmita, Wahyuni; Rahmi, Nur; Tunnisa, Khaera; Amal, Muhammad Ikhlashul
BAREKENG: Jurnal Ilmu Matematika dan Terapan Vol 19 No 3 (2025): BAREKENG: Journal of Mathematics and Its Application
Publisher : PATTIMURA UNIVERSITY

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.30598/barekengvol19iss3pp1553-1564

Abstract

The sustainability of defined benefit pension plans relies heavily on effective funding strategies. This study aims to develop an optimized funding strategy for Defined Benefit Pension Plans by integrating the Entry Age Normal (EAN) method with the Single Salary Approach (SSA). The Entry Age Normal method provides a systematic way to distribute the cost of pension benefits over the career of employees, ensuring long-term stability. Meanwhile, the Single Salary Approach simplifies salary projections, making it easier to manage fund contributions while accounting for future wage inflation. To evaluate the effectiveness of this integrated approach, we conducted a case study using salary and pension fund data collected from internal records at Institut Teknologi Bacharuddin Jusuf Habibie (ITH), a higher education institution. Through a series of simulations and sensitivity analyses, we demonstrate that integrating these methods not only minimizes funding volatility but also improves the accuracy of pension liabilities estimation. For instance, at age 25.83, the actuarial liability is Rp 38,929,501, reflecting a relatively low liability at a younger age. As employees approach retirement, the liability increases significantly. At age 47.17, the liability reaches Rp 191,823,284, demonstrating the impact of salary growth and length of service on future benefits. Additionally, for the same age of 25.83, the actuarial liability under SSA-EAN is Rp 37,980,001, which is slightly lower than the EAN estimate. Pension benefits projected under SSA-EAN are also slightly lower than those under EAN, indicating potential cost savings. The findings provide a viable framework for pension plan administrators seeking to achieve both financial sustainability and predictability in managing pension obligations. By integrating SSA with EAN, this study offers a practical solution that addresses key challenges in the actuarial valuation of defined benefit plans, ensuring more stable and predictable pension funding.

Employee Benefits Program Valuation with Multiple Decrement Model Based on PSAK 24 Post-COVID-19 Pandemic Ekasasmita, Wahyuni; Rahmi, Nur; Iskandar, M. Fauzan
JTAM (Jurnal Teori dan Aplikasi Matematika) Vol 8, No 1 (2024): January
Publisher : Universitas Muhammadiyah Mataram

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.31764/jtam.v8i1.17417

Abstract

In this article, we evaluate the post-labor compensation program based on PSAK-24 in the new normal era of the COVID-19 pandemic. In order to create a table multiple decrements based on a single table decrement namely, death, withdrawal, total permanent disability, and retirement. In the new normal era of the COVID-19 pandemic, the benefits of death, death caused by COVID-19, withdrawal, total permanent disability, and retirement were then aggregated. The method used in this study is a quantitative method with a case study approach of COVID-19. The data used is secondary data on the number of COVID-19 positive cases in Indonesia from January 2021 to December 2022. In this study, an actuarial model, the Multiple Decrement Model, was applied to calculate the valuation of the post-labor compensation program based on PSAK-24 using five decrements as the cause of claims consisting of death, death cause of COVID-19, withdrawal, total permanent disability and retirement. The calculation results that can be seen that large annual net premiums multiple decrement cases that provide benefits according to the cause of failure getting bigger as that person gets older.
